一种用户运动线路规划方法、用户终端、服务器端及智能手环技术

技术编号:18167153 阅读:43 留言:0更新日期:2018-06-09 12:29
本发明专利技术公开了一种用户运动线路规划方法、用户终端、服务器端及智能手环,涉及运动领域,用户终端包括规划指令发送模块和线路规划数据接收模块,服务器端包括规划指令接收模块、运动线路规划模块和线路规划数据发送模块;用户终端被配置为:发送运动线路规划指令到服务器端;接收服务器端发送的线路规划数据。服务器端被配置为:接收用户终端发送的运动线路规划指令;根据起点位置、终点位置以及运动目标参数,在起点位置和终点位置之间规划至少一与运动目标参数相匹配的运动线路;发送运动线路到用户终端。本发明专利技术避免用户耗费时间尽力去找寻运动线路,提高用户便捷性。同时,基于运动目标参数为用户规划线路,提高用户运动目标完成的精确性。

【技术实现步骤摘要】
一种用户运动线路规划方法、用户终端、服务器端及智能手环
本专利技术涉及运动健康领域,特别涉及一种用户运动线路规划方法、用户终端、服务器端及智能手环。
技术介绍
随着科技的发展以及人民生活水平的提高,越来越多的人们进行运动锻炼身体。人们进行锻炼的目的很多,包括为了健康、减肥、爱好或者健身。同时,由于交通的发展、便民公园基础建设的日益完善,越来越多的人加入了跑步、或者骑行的运动项目中来。在现有技术中,对于长期坚持跑步或者骑行的人员而言,常常是以固定的线路进行跑步,使得运动作为一项比较单一枯燥的活动,使其缺少运动积极性。同时,对于外地人而言,初次来到新地点,对本地的运动线路并不清楚,浪费其寻找跑步、骑行新线路的时间。
技术实现思路
有鉴于现有技术的上述缺陷,本专利技术所要解决的技术问题是提供一种用户运动线路规划方法,旨在解决现有技术不能为用户规划线路的问题,同时,本专利技术旨在基于运动目标参数为用户规划线路,提高用户运动目标完成的精确性。在本专利技术的两个方面,分别在用户终端侧和服务器端侧对所要解决的技术问题提供相应的技术方案。为实现上述目的,在第一方面中,提供一种用户运动线路规划用户终端,所述用户终端包括:规划指令发送模块,用于发送运动线路规划指令到服务器端;所述运动线路规划指令包括本次运动的起点位置、终点位置以及运动目标参数;所述运动目标参数,包括健身目标参数、目标锻炼强度、食物摄入量和/或目标运动里程;线路规划数据接收模块,用于接收服务器端发送的线路规划数据;所述线路规划数据是所述服务器端根据所述起点位置、所述终点位置以及所述运动目标参数,在所述起点位置和所述终点位置之间规划至少一与所述运动目标参数相匹配的运动线路。在一具体实施方式中,所述用户终端,还包括:第一目标运动里程求解单元,用于根据所述健身目标参数、所述目标锻炼强度和/或所述食物摄入量,生成所述目标运动里程。在一具体实施方式中,所述用户终端,还包括:用户请求响应模块,用于响应于用户运动线路规划请求指令,获取所述起点位置。可选的,所述用户运动线路规划请求指令可以是用户点击用户终端或者输入指令而生成。在一具体实施方式中,所述用户终端,还包括:可选运动线路展示模块,用于根据所述线路规划数据,展示至少一与所述运动目标参数相匹配的运动线路;线路选择响应模块,用于响应于用户线路选择操作,向所述服务器端发送所述线路选择指令。可选的,所述线路选择指令包括用户所选择的线路信息。在一具体实施方式中,所述用户终端,还包括:导航模块,用于响应于用户线路选择操作,执行所选择线路的导航操作。在本专利技术的第二方面中,提供一种用户运动线路规划服务器端,所述服务器端包括:规划指令接收模块,用于接收用户终端发送的运动线路规划指令;所述运动线路规划指令包括本次运动的起点位置、终点位置以及运动目标参数;所述运动目标参数,包括健身目标参数、目标锻炼强度、食物摄入量和/或目标运动里程;运动线路规划模块,用于根据所述起点位置、所述终点位置以及所述运动目标参数,在所述起点位置和所述终点位置之间规划至少一与所述运动目标参数相匹配的运动线路;线路规划数据发送模块,用于发送至少一所述运动线路到所述用户终端。在一具体实施方式中,所述运动线路规划模块,还包括:第二目标运动里程求解单元,用于根据所述健身目标参数、所述目标锻炼强度和/或所述食物摄入量,生成所述目标运动里程。在一具体实施方式中,所述运动线路规划模块,还包括:基准里程求解单元,用于根据所述健身目标参数、所述目标锻炼强度和/或所述食物摄入量,生成目标运动基准里程值;第三目标运动里程求解单元,用于根据地图上的上下坡信息,对所述目标运动基准里程值进行校正,生成所述目标运动里程。在一具体实施方式中,所述运动线路规划模块,还包括:分段线路单元获取单元,用于获取地图上的若干个可选的运动线路单元,所述运动线路单元包括单元锻炼强度值、单元运动里程值和/或单元食物消耗值;第四目标运动里程求解单元,用于根据所述目标锻炼强度、所述目标运动里程和/或所述食物摄入量以及所述单元锻炼强度值、所述单元运动里程值和/或所述单元食物消耗值,选取连续的所述运动线路单元,生成所述运动线路。在一具体实施方式中,所述运动线路规划模块,还包括:第一规划线路生成模块,用于获取所述起点位置与所述终点位置,生成第一规划线路;第一规划线路修正模块,响应于所述第一规划线路与所述运动目标参数的不相匹配,修正所述第一规划线路;运动线路确定模块,将与所述运动目标参数相匹配的修正后的所述第一规划线路确定为所述运动线路。与第一方面相对应地,在第三方面中,提供一种用户运动线路规划方法,所述方法包括:发送运动线路规划指令到服务器端;所述运动线路规划指令包括本次运动的起点位置、终点位置以及运动目标参数;所述运动目标参数,包括健身目标参数、目标锻炼强度、食物摄入量和/或目标运动里程;接收服务器端发送的线路规划数据;所述线路规划数据是所述服务器端根据所述起点位置、所述终点位置以及所述运动目标参数,在所述起点位置和所述终点位置之间规划至少一与所述运动目标参数相匹配的运动线路。在一具体实施方式中,所述方法,还包括:根据所述健身目标参数、所述目标锻炼强度和/或所述食物摄入量,生成所述目标运动里程。在一具体实施方式中,所述方法还包括:响应于用户运动线路规划请求指令,获取所述起点位置。可选的,所述用户运动线路规划请求指令可以是用户点击用户终端或者输入指令而生成。在一具体实施方式中,所述方法还包括:根据所述线路规划数据,展示至少一与所述运动目标参数相匹配的运动线路;响应于用户线路选择操作,向所述服务器端发送所述线路选择指令。可选的,所述线路选择指令包括用户所选择的线路信息。进一步而言,所述方法,还包括:响应于用户线路选择操作,执行所选择线路的导航操作。与第二方面相对应地,在第四方面中,提供一种用户运动线路规划方法,所述方法包括:接收用户终端发送的运动线路规划指令;所述运动线路规划指令包括本次运动的起点位置、终点位置以及运动目标参数;所述运动目标参数,包括健身目标参数、目标锻炼强度、食物摄入量和/或目标运动里程;根据所述起点位置、所述终点位置以及所述运动目标参数,在所述起点位置和所述终点位置之间规划至少一与所述运动目标参数相匹配的运动线路;发送至少一所述运动线路到所述用户终端。在一具体实施方式中,所述方法,还包括:根据所述健身目标参数、所述目标锻炼强度和/或所述食物摄入量,生成所述目标运动里程。在一具体实施方式中,所述方法还包括:根据所述健身目标参数、所述目标锻炼强度和/或所述食物摄入量,生成目标运动基准里程值;根据地图上的上下坡信息,对所述目标运动基准里程值进行校正,生成所述目标运动里程。在一具体实施方式中,所述方法还包括:获取地图上的若干个可选的运动线路单元,所述运动线路单元包括单元锻炼强度值、单元运动里程值和/或单元食物消耗值;根据所述目标锻炼强度、所述目标运动里程和/或所述食物摄入量以及所述单元锻炼强度值、所述单元运动里程值和/或所述单元食物消耗值,选取连续的所述运动线路单元,生成所述运动线路。在一具体实施方式中,所述方法还包括:获取所述起点位置与所述终点位置,生成第一规划线路;响应于所述第一规划线路与所述运动目标参数的不相匹本文档来自技高网...
一种用户运动线路规划方法、用户终端、服务器端及智能手环

【技术保护点】
一种用户运动线路规划用户终端,其特征在于,所述用户终端包括:规划指令发送模块,用于发送运动线路规划指令到服务器端;所述运动线路规划指令包括本次运动的起点位置、终点位置以及运动目标参数;所述运动目标参数,包括健身目标参数、目标锻炼强度、食物摄入量和/或目标运动里程;线路规划数据接收模块,用于接收服务器端发送的线路规划数据;所述线路规划数据是所述服务器端根据所述起点位置、所述终点位置以及所述运动目标参数,在所述起点位置和所述终点位置之间规划至少一与所述运动目标参数相匹配的运动线路。

【技术特征摘要】
1.一种用户运动线路规划用户终端,其特征在于,所述用户终端包括:规划指令发送模块,用于发送运动线路规划指令到服务器端;所述运动线路规划指令包括本次运动的起点位置、终点位置以及运动目标参数;所述运动目标参数,包括健身目标参数、目标锻炼强度、食物摄入量和/或目标运动里程;线路规划数据接收模块,用于接收服务器端发送的线路规划数据;所述线路规划数据是所述服务器端根据所述起点位置、所述终点位置以及所述运动目标参数,在所述起点位置和所述终点位置之间规划至少一与所述运动目标参数相匹配的运动线路。2.如权利要求1所述的一种用户运动线路规划用户终端,其特征在于,所述用户终端,还包括:第一目标运动里程求解单元,用于根据所述健身目标参数、所述目标锻炼强度和/或所述食物摄入量,生成所述目标运动里程。3.如权利要求1所述的一种用户运动线路规划用户终端,其特征在于,所述用户终端,还包括:用户请求响应模块,用于响应于用户运动线路规划请求指令,获取所述起点位置。可选的,所述用户运动线路规划请求指令可以是用户点击用户终端或者输入指令而生成。4.如权利要求1所述的一种用户运动线路规划用户终端,其特征在于,所述用户终端,还包括:可选运动线路展示模块,用于根据所述线路规划数据,展示至少一与所述运动目标参数相匹配的运动线路;线路选择响应模块,用于响应于用户线路选择操作,向所述服务器端发送所述线路选择指令。可选的,所述线路选择指令包括用户所选择的线路信息。5.一种智能手环,其特征在于,所述智能手环包括:手环本体、嵌设于所述手环本体内的GPS模块、存储器、处理器、输入模块、无线通讯模块以及嵌设于所述手环本体上的显示模块;所述无线通讯模块用于与服务器端通讯连接;所述GPS模块,用于提供当前位置信息;所述显示模块,用于展示规划线路;所述输入模块,用于接收用户的操作指令;所述存储器,用于存放程序以及地图;所述处理器,用于执行所述存储器存储的程序,所述程序使得所述处理器执行以下操作:发送运动线路规划指令到服务器端;所述运动线路规划指令包括本次运动的起点位置、终点位置以及运动目标参数;所述运动目标参数,包括健身目标参数、目标锻炼强度、食物摄入量和/或目标运动里程;接收服务器端发送的线路规划数据;所述线路规划数据是所述服务器端根据所述起...

【专利技术属性】
技术研发人员:林锑杭
申请(专利权)人:莆田市烛火信息技术有限公司
类型:发明
国别省市:福建,35

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1